Abstract

AbstractThis paper presents a literature review on network models in data envelopment analysis (DEA) focused on the slack‐based network model called slacks‐based measure‐network data envelopment analysis (SBM‐NDEA). The search was carried out in an international database, resulting in 97 publications in the period from 2009 to 2021. From these publications, a descriptive analysis is performed, the evolution of the literature is mapped, the articles are organized into categories, and the main methodological references for the models and applications used are identified. Also, the most used models and their main characteristics are described, in addition to the analysis of the applications. Moreover, the sectors and countries with the highest number of applications are also identified. Through this review, it was possible to observe an increase in the number of network studies using the SBM‐NDEA in recent years. Finally, directions for future research in SBM‐NDEA are suggested.
